Nice burnt umber color with white cap.

Very pleasant aroma of caramel, toffee and white chocolate.

Taste on entry is a sweetish mix of rich caramel, white chocolate and a touch of vanilla. Good flavors but that's about it, somewhat simple brew but easy to drink.

Medium texture with balancing carbonation.

A competently made brew in whatever style a White Russian Imperial Stout is. I gave the last few ounces to our resident Guinness fan to get his take on this white stout and he said, "tastes like a frappuccino with vanilla" and since he and the plus one are diehard Starbucks types I'll take his word for it.

12 oz can purchased from Jackson, MS into Calusa Snifter.

Pours a burnt orange/honey color with a white fuzzy/frothy head of 1 finger. Nice lacing sticks to the glass.

Tons of honey and clean cold coffee on the nose; slight chocolate, and slight acidic pepper.

I'm gonna revise this because I'm having it for the second time now. Flavor is still different from anything else I've ever experienced. Nice vanilla cookie and some Tone's caramel syrup. Slight vanilla wafer. Lots of earthy and piney hop presence. Cold brewed coffee. Vanilla bean. More earth. Still there's a nice dessert aspect to it.

Feel is very carbonated, way too carbonated for a Russian Imperial Stout but I will cut it some slack because of the "white" element.

Overall, I can see what they were going for here. It comes across a bit too piney/earthy but it's not overwhelming. I bumped my score up because the 2nd can was better than the first. Interesting white mocha russian stout with large piney dank hops.
